A Professional Teeth Cleaning Creates a Good Feeling Physically and Mentally

Of course part of a teeth cleaning’s appeal is the remarkable sensation that you get afterward. However, the good feeling hardly ends with the physical sensation. A tooth cleaning should have you feeling just as good mentally. To have your teeth cleaned is to remove the buildup of harmful bacteria that wear through your enamel and cause cavities. Cleaning away plaque and tartar keeps your teeth healthy and safe from long-term problems like gum disease and decay.

Teeth Cleanings Correspond with Important Checkups

Having your teeth cleaned is only part of the experience. Scheduling these regular appointments gives your dentist a chance to check in and see what has changed with your mouth. Your dentist can point out areas of concern or share ways to improve your home care technique. Don’t miss out on a dental cleaning or the important checkups that come along with it.
